Deming management method: (Paperback)

"'Deming Management Method' is an outstanding book on the quality management methods advocated by one of the best known quality gurus of the last century. Deming became famous for his teaching on quality that transformed Japan from being a country known for producing shoddy products to one that achieved outstanding success in the 1980s and 1990s. The author, a close associate of Deming over many years, methodically traces the life and teachings of Deming, explaining his famous 14 points and how they can be used to transform a company into an excellent organization that produces high quality goods and services to meet customer needs, using motivated people. The book is an important addition to the library of any manager that wishes to see his/her company achieve success."

The Wisdom of Teams: Creating the High-Performance Organization (Paperback)

"The importance of teams has become a cliche of modern business theory, but few have a clear idea of what it means. In this new edition of their best-selling primer, Katzenbach and Smith try to impart some analytical rigor to the concept. Drawing on their experience as management consultants and a plethora of case studies at companies like Burlington Northern and Motorola, they cover such topics as the optimal size of teams, coping with turnover in team personnel and nurturing 'extraordinary teams' rather than 'pseudo-teams.'  This book is the result of research into why teams are important, what separates effective from ineffective teams, and how organizations can tap the effectiveness of teams to become high-performance organizations."

The Skilled Facilitator: (Hardcover)

"In The Skilled Facilitator: Practical Wisdom For Developing Effective Groups, Roger Schwarz draws on his own extensive facilitation experience and insight to bring together theory and practice, creating a comprehensive reference for consultants, peer facilitators, mangers, leaders -- anyone whose role is to guide groups toward realization their creative and problem-solving potential. The Skilled Facilitator provides essential materials including simple but effective ground rules for governing group interaction; what to say to a group (and when to say it) to keep it on track and moving toward its goal, proven techniques for starting meetings on the right (and ending them positively and decisively), practical methods for handling emotions (particularly negative emotions) when they arise in a group context, and a diagnostic approach for helping both facilitators and group members identify and solve problems that can undermine the group process. The Skilled Facilitator provides a clearly defined set of basic principles to help facilitators develop sound, value-based responses to a wide range of unpredictable situations. It also includes advice on how to work with outside consultants and facilitate within one's own organizations, along with a groundbreaking section on facilitative leadership. The Skilled Facilitator is an excellent addition to any business or community library shelf."
